Yanlong Hou is a scholar working on Nephrology,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yanlong Hou has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 452 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 2 papers in Nephrology, 2 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 2 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Yanlong Hou's work include Gout, Hyperuricemia, Uric Acid (2 papers), Remote-Sensing Image Classification (1 paper) and Viral Infections and Immunology Research (1 paper). Yanlong Hou is often cited by papers focused on Gout, Hyperuricemia, Uric Acid (2 papers), Remote-Sensing Image Classification (1 paper) and Viral Infections and Immunology Research (1 paper). Yanlong Hou collaborates with scholars based in China. Yanlong Hou's co-authors include Chongge You, Peipei Song, Wei Li, Xiaolan Yang, Meijuan Yang, Chunxia Wang, Yao Ma, Yubin Wang, Chenglong He and Baochang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as Clinica Chimica Acta, Lipids in Health and Disease and Diagnosis.
